简介 PROBLEM TO BE SOLVED : To provide a biaxial oriented thin film for an oxide super-conducting wire capable of shortening the manufacturing time and reducing the manufacturing cost due to the high film deposition rate, and its manufacturing method. SOLUTION : In the biaxial oriented thin film for the oxide super-conducting wire, an intermediate layer 20 (a thin film) is layered on a base material 10, and a rare earth oxide super-conducting layer 30 is layered on the intermediate layer 20. The biaxial oriented thin film is formed of an oxide of a scheelite structure having the biaxial orientation. The thin film having the biaxial orientation to be layered on the base material 10 is layered by the ion beam assist vapor deposition method. The intermediate layer 20 is formed of one of YNbO4and GdNbO4having the scheelite structure. COPYRIGHT : (C)2010, JPO&INPIT
